I'm looking for mountain land and came across very cheap Sneedville property. What is wrong with the area, why is it so cheap? Will this be the new Western NC soon? Is it a good time to buy? Anywhere else in East TN this cheap?

Sneedville is in a rural area of northeast Tennessee near the Kentucky/Virginia state line. If you search for it on Mapquest, you will see that Sneedville is not close to any larger town or city. That is likely why you are finding that land is less expensive there. Land near larger cities such as Knoxville, Chattanoga, or Nashville will be more costly.

We looked at some land around Sneedville. It was pretty darn vertical if I remember correctly, and equally remote. You need to check out the exact property you are interested in. I remember a picture I saw of one piece of land, looked like it would be reasonable, but when we got there discovered they had taken the picture of the view not of the property, and the only flat area was the railroad bed that ran across the front of the property. Another one, they took the pic from the top of the property, and it was pretty much a cliff. I still can't figure out how they got up to it.

As stated before Sneedville is in the middle of nowhere... about an hour outside of JC, Kingsport, or Knoxville... and it is not connected to any city by interstate... just state routes.

Oh, and parts are in the "hills"... hope you enjoy snow and ice.

Nice place though if you want peace and quiet and don't want the luxuries of living around cities.
